Jam along to local musos

Enjoy an afternoon packed with local entertainment with friends and family on Heritage Day.

CELEBRATE Heritage Day with family and friends at Jam in the Park at the Shongweni Club.

The event – with a heart for local – showcases the best talent from KZN while also raising funds for local heroine Jes Foord’s foundation to help fight gender-based violence.

It will start at 12:00 on Tuesday, September 24, and will feature artists like Carmen Rodrigues who is enjoying national success with her latest single, Surprise!

It will also feature Kickstands, the laid-back vibes of the Meditators and Pete Guthrie’s new project.

Food and beverages will be available from the club, including braai packs and braai facilities. Do not bring your own. Book tickets at pre-sale rates at webtickets.co.za.

The entrance fee is R150 for adults, children under 12 will pay R80, and children under six enter for free.
